首页 > 生活常识 >

ods格式如何改成excel

2025-07-21 12:55:50

问题描述:

ods格式如何改成excel,求大佬施舍一个解决方案,感激不尽!

最佳答案

推荐答案

2025-07-21 12:55:50

ods格式如何改成excel】ODS(OpenDocument Spreadsheet)是一种由OASIS标准定义的开放文档格式,主要用于LibreOffice和Apache OpenOffice等办公软件中。而Excel是微软公司开发的电子表格软件,广泛用于数据处理、分析和展示。在实际工作中,有时需要将ODS文件转换为Excel格式,以便与其他用户或系统兼容。

以下是一些常见的方法,可以帮助你将ODS文件转换为Excel格式,并以加表格的形式进行展示。

一、常见转换方法总结

方法 操作步骤 优点 缺点
使用LibreOffice 打开ODS文件 → 文件 → 另存为 → 选择“Microsoft Excel 97-2003 (.xls)”或“Excel 2007+ (.xlsx)” 免费、支持多种格式转换 需要安装LibreOffice软件
使用在线转换工具 访问在线转换网站(如CloudConvert、OnlineConvert等)→ 上传ODS文件 → 转换为Excel → 下载结果 不需要安装软件 可能存在隐私风险
使用Google Sheets 将ODS文件上传至Google Drive → 右键打开方式 → 选择Google Sheets → 导出为Excel 简单易用、无需安装 依赖网络连接
使用Python脚本 使用`pyodf`库读取ODS文件,再用`pandas`写入Excel文件 自动化、适合批量处理 需要编程基础

二、详细操作说明

1. 使用LibreOffice转换

- 安装LibreOffice后,打开ODS文件。

- 点击“文件” → “另存为”。

- 在保存类型中选择“Microsoft Excel 97-2003 (.xls)”或“Excel 2007+ (.xlsx)”。

- 点击保存即可完成转换。

2. 使用在线工具转换

- 打开一个在线转换网站(如 [https://cloudconvert.com](https://cloudconvert.com))。

- 上传你的ODS文件。

- 选择目标格式为Excel。

- 等待转换完成后下载文件。

3. 使用Google Sheets转换

- 将ODS文件上传到Google Drive。

- 右键点击文件 → 选择“用Google Sheets打开”。

- 打开后,点击“文件” → “下载” → 选择“Microsoft Excel (.xlsx)”格式。

4. 使用Python脚本转换

- 安装必要的库:

```bash

pip install pyodf pandas openpyxl

```

- 编写脚本:

```python

from pyodf import Document

import pandas as pd

doc = Document('your_file.ods')

df = pd.read_excel('your_file.xlsx', sheet_name=0)

df.to_excel('output.xlsx', index=False)

```

三、注意事项

- 兼容性问题:某些复杂的公式或格式可能在转换过程中丢失。

- 文件大小限制:在线工具通常对文件大小有限制,大文件建议使用本地软件。

- 安全性:在线转换时,注意不要上传敏感信息。

通过以上方法,你可以轻松地将ODS格式转换为Excel格式,满足不同的使用需求。根据自身情况选择最合适的方式即可。

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。